I am new to the AOSP, downloaded the 5.1.1 source, built and installed the image in nexus 9 successfully.
Now, I need to do modifications to fulfil my objectives and for that I have to know the package manager source which is primarily responsible for installing apps in the android device. I believe that it is somewhere within the system folder but unable to locate exact the source directory. Any help in this regard is highly appreciated.

frameworks/base/services/core/java/com/android/server/pm/PackageManagerService.java
